Background & Context

Matlock, starring Kathy Bates as Madeline Kingston, premiered on CBS in September 2024 and follows a retired lawyer who assumes a false identity at Jacobson Moore law firm. Tracker, also on CBS, debuted in February 2024 and follows former tracker Colter Shaw (Justin Hartley) solving missing-person cases.

Core Event: Ritter’s Crossover Proposal

In August 2025, Jason Ritter (Julian Markston, Matlock) told Us Weekly he would welcome a storyline linking Julian with Hartley’s Colter Shaw. He suggested Julian could leave the firm, learn tracking, and possibly become a “damsel in distress” on Tracker.

Tracker’s third season is slated for 22 episodes; 18 have aired by May 2026. Matlock has been renewed for a third season, with its premiere date pending. Both series air Sunday nights on CBS.

Ritter highlighted his friendship with Hartley and proposed Julian train in tracking, joking his character would likely be captured and need rescue. CBS lists Tracker at 9 p.m. ET on Sundays, with next-day streaming on Paramount+.

Criticism & Opposition

Marshall questioned Ritter’s “rugged” portrayal, describing his on-set attempts as “making my stomach crawl.” She also warned Ritter would be the one kidnapped and urged producers not to arm his character.

Verbatim Quotes

  • “Justin and I are very friendly. I really love him. He’s such a nice guy,” — Jason Ritter
  • “Jason comes to set now, and he squints his eyes and he tries to play a rugged guy. And we’re like, ‘Can you please stop?'” — Skye P. Marshall
  • “But I feel like he’d be the guy that gets kidnapped,” — Skye P. Marshall
  • “She’s probably right. Who knows? It’s TV, so anything can happen. A guy like me can be a hero on TV but in real life, if I was on Tracker, I’d be like, ‘All right, I got these guys … Oh, one of them snuck up behind me and that’s the end for me. Save me, please. I’ve made this mission 20 times harder by being captured.'” — Jason Ritter

What’s Next

Tracker will end its third season on May 24 2026; Matlock’s third season is slated for later 2026 or 2027. No official crossover has been announced, leaving the idea speculative.
